Tragic Juliet
These days have faded Your nights are dead Mush together Inside her head The act is so selfish Her lips quiver in fear She knows it’s over She senses you’re there She won’t blackmail you again Her mental wounds you can’t mend. Juliet however still reaches For your hand. She still loves you. And wishes you’d understand Why won’t you hold her anymore? He screams still echo As you slam the door. She stands alone It was your mistake too. Yet you blame her. Have you forgotten That it was you? You stole her innocence You didn’t think twice So why is it only Her paying for the crime. She kept your letters She remembered those date’s But you forget her It’s her that you hate She stands alone. Skin pale Knife in her hands She gets on her knees Ready to meet her fate. You turn down the corridor Run back to the door Sweet Juliet She’s lying dead on the floor.
